About Study Course
Objective
To develop knowledge and skills about the work of a classroom educator on the basis of the objectives, tasks and different didactic approaches included in the standard of primary education and general secondary education, their implementation during classroom hours. Acquired knowledge, skills to be applied in pedagogical placements to perform the functions of a classroom educator and to manage project work.
Preliminary Knowledge
Knowledge of the pedagogical process in school, inclusive education, regulatory framework. Ability to plan, organize and manage the learning process, choose appropriate teaching methods, ensure a safe learning environment, evaluate performance and reflect on professional activity.

Based on the material given in the lecture, compile information, develop and present a plan for a project week for a primary school class specified by the lecturer, linking two learning areas. Specify: the goal, the expected result, the plan for the project week, the methods, the division of responsibilities, the necessary inventory/equipment, and the financing. Specify references from each subject standard included in the project (Regulation No. 747 of the Cabinet of Ministers "Regulations on the State Standard for Basic Education and Sample Subject Standards for Basic Education"). The exam consists of 3 questions to be answered in free form. The questions cover topics on the duties of the class teacher, documentation, work in class hours and class management, work with parents of students, as well as planning of project week, interdisciplinary links, methods of work with students. Students who have successfully completed all independent works are admitted to the exam. |
